Major mobile carriers in Latvia
- Bite — strong urban 5G and competitive roaming deals.
- LMT — Latvia’s largest network with the widest rural coverage and consistent speeds.
- Tele2 — good balance of price and performance, solid in towns and along main roads.
Network speed and coverage
LMT typically delivers the best rural coverage and stable downloads outside Riga; Bite and Tele2 both offer comparable 5G/4G performance inside cities and along highways. Expect 4G in most towns and 5G hotspots in Riga, Jurmala and other major centers.
Real-world expectations
- Riga: consistent 5G/4G speeds suitable for HD streaming and fast uploads.
- Smaller towns: mostly 4G; speeds good for video calls and maps.
- Remote countryside and forests: only LMT regularly holds better coverage.
Which network is best for tourists
Pick LMT if your trip includes rural day trips or national parks; choose Bite or Tele2 if you’ll stay mostly in Riga or coastal resorts. Unlimited eSIM plans sold through the product page can roam across these carrier networks depending on the plan—check the plan details before purchase.

Common mistakes to avoid
- Assuming 5G is everywhere — 5G is mainly urban; rural areas rely on 4G.
- Buying a fixed small-data plan when you need hotspot for laptops — unlimited is simpler.
- Not checking activation window — purchased eSIMs usually require activation within 180 days.
- Failing to verify device eSIM support — check compatible devices first.
